Sewer Backup Water Removal Cost in North Brunswick, NJ

The cost of Sewer Backup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in North Brunswick, NJ. These estimates are based on our experience and should give you a general idea of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Water Removal $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water, equipment needed, and labor required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or required.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or required.
Final Inspection and Restoration $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or required.

Common Questions About Sewer Backup Water Removal

Q: What causes sewer backups?

Sewer backups can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, clogged pipes, and aging infrastructure.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and develop a plan to address it.

Q: Will my insurance cover the cost of sewer backup water removal?

It depends on your insurance policy and the specific circumstances of the event. We recommend checking with your insurance provider to find out your coverage and options.

Q: How long will it take to restore my property?

The length of time it takes to restore your property will depend on the severity of the damage and the scope of the job.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and ensure your property is safe to occupy as soon as possible.

Q: Can I prevent sewer backups from happening in the first place?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ent sewer backups from occurring, including regular maintenance, inspections, and proper disposal of grease and other substances that can clog pipes. Our team can help you develop a plan to prevent sewer backups and keep your property safe.
